    I'm wondering if anyone has found a good, clean solution to the weak headphone amp in the Xbox Core Controller? The DAC and amp in it are rather poor and I find it struggles to power a descent pair of headphones. With my Sennheiser HD579's I have to listen at 80-90% for a good listening volume and even then it lacks almost any bass.

    I don't understand why Microsoft doesn't allow us to connect Bluetooth headphones but if they are going to force us to connect to the controller than the very least they could do is include a good DAC and amp in it.

    I know you can get external amps but I don't want any more wires to get tangled up in or an amp on my lap that's always in the way.

    I thing audio is every bit as important as the graphics and I would happily paid another $5-$10 if it meant getting good quality audio.

    A good DAC and amp is very expensive, it’s not going in a controller, heat and power requirements aside. It’s not a feature 95% of users would care enough about to make it standard. A good DAC like Burr-Brown would be as expensive as the rest of the controller all by itself at manufacture.

    Buy a good receiver, connect console with HDMI, you're good to go for a large variety of applications. Many of them include your Bluetooth support as well.

    Microsoft uses Wifi Direct for accessories, that has a great deal more bandwidth than Bluetooth, and they require security chips be present in all of them. When you buy a PC, you’re paying retail for a device. When you buy a game console, from anyone, that price is usually as close to, and often under, their cost of making it. That money is recovered through game and accessory sales, just like Sony and Nintendo.

    Another option is to buy a wireless headset, but I’d audition them. Anything designed to run off a battery will limit bass because it’s hugely power hungry, so you need to find the one right for you

    If you're having audio issues with groups, try the following solutions.

    If you can't hear chat audio when using the Xbox One chat headset, or if others can't hear you, try the following solutions first.

    Disconnect the headphones or disconnect the headphone cable from the bottom of the controller and reconnect it firmly.
    Check the mute button on the headphone controls to make sure the headphones are not muted.

    Illustration showing an arrow and a finger pointing to the mute button on the headphone controls.
    Illustration showing an arrow and a finger pointing to the sliding mute button on the 3.5mm headphone cable.

    Turn up the volume. If you use headphones connected to the 3.5mm port, go to Profile & system > Settings > Devices & connections > Accessories, then select your controller to adjust the audio options.
    Note If you use the headset with a Windows computer, go to Settings, choose Devices, select your controller, and then adjust the audio options.

    Try using another controller or headset to see if the hardware is working properly.
    Make sure you have the latest software:
    Update Xbox Wireless Controller
    Aspects that you should take into account:
    Never pull on the headphone cable when removing it from the controller. To remove the headphones, pull on the body of the headphone jack.

    The Xbox One Headset is designed for use with Xbox controllers only. Xbox consoles don't stream game sound or music through the Xbox One Headset. If you're looking for an Xbox headset that you can play and chat with, check out:

    Set up and troubleshoot the Xbox One Adapter and Stereo Headset
    Set up your Xbox Wireless Headset
    If the problem persists, try the following solutions:
    Solutions
    Examine the headphones, cable, and connector for visible defects.

    Make sure there is no dust or dirt on the headphone jack. To clean the connector, use a cotton swab soaked in alcohol.
    Check that your Xbox controller is working properly. For help troubleshooting driver issues, see:

    My controller does not connect or turn on
    Firmly insert the Xbox One Headset connector into the expansion port located under the D-pad and right stick on the controller.
